I made the opposite move from Toronto to Vancouver. Vancouver is a nice place from a natural beauty and weather perspective (weather is subjective; I like cloudy and rainy winters over cold and slushy but I know people that hate the weather in Vancouver as well). It's a decent place for pretty much decent at everything, and really extraordinary for outdoors activity (especially skiing and snowboarding is top notch and super accessible) but it's very obviously a much smaller and much more cut-off/isolated place than Toronto in my opinion.

I find overall Toronto has way more opportunity from a career perspective, night life is incomparable, restaurant scene is leaps and bounds above Vancouver, etc. It feels much more alive and buzzing with more going on on any given weekend.

I've been in Vancouver for 2 years now and I've adapted/made some friends here, but it's only a matter of time until I go back. I still like it in Vancouver and it's a fine city, but I don't find it fits with my career ambitions and what I want out of life.
